A circle (with centre at O) is touching two intersecting lines AX and BY. The two points of contact A and B subtend an angle of `65^(@)` at any point C on the circumference of the circle. If P is the point of intersection for the two lines, then the measure of `angle APO` is :

A

`25^@`

B

`65^@`

C

`90^@`

D

`40^@`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A
